The Bangladesh Center for Refugee Law Studies is a research and knowledge platform focused on refugee law, forced displacement, rights, policy and justice.
BCRLS is a research and knowledge platform focused on refugee law, forced displacement and related questions of rights, policy and justice.
Through research, education and dialogue, BCRLS aims to connect evidence with meaningful action and contribute to informed discussion on issues affecting refugees, displaced communities and other vulnerable populations.
the Center seeks to provide a space where scholars, researchers, students, practitioners, policymakers and other stakeholders can engage with important questions of refugee law and displacement.
Its work is intended to strengthen knowledge, encourage interdisciplinary research and promote greater understanding of the legal, social and policy dimensions of displacement.
